2 Samuel 17:26 Meaning and Commentary

2 Samuel 17:26

So Israel and Absalom pitched in the land of Gilead.
] Which belonged to the tribes of Reuben and Gad, and the half tribe of Manasseh; here the Israelites that were with Absalom encamped, in order to give battle to David and his men.
